". . . some of the varieties will attain the size of elms if given room for their roots and a chance to spread their branches."

What is the tone of the excerpt?


informal and objective

formal and objective

informal and subjective

formal and subjective

Answers

Answer 1

Answer: Formal and objective.

Explanation:

The tone of the excerpt is formal and objective. A formal writing tone is a tone which is thorough, direct, and also emphasizes facts.

An objective tone is impartial and it is used when one gives a neutral, factual and unbiased information. In such tone, there's no feeling shown towards the topic. Since the excerpt is based on facts and unbiased, then it uses a formal and objective tone.

seema tells a joke passive voice​

Answers

Answer:

A joke was told by Seema.

Explanation:

In the rewritten passive sentence above, Seema who was the subject of the given sentence becomes the object. This is how passive sentence are phrased. Instead of the subject to perform an action on the object, the subject rather receives the action and the object assumes the position of the subject.

Therefore, while the first sentence- "Seema tells a joke," is in the active voice, the sentence, "A joke was told by Seema," is in the passive voice.

Anna asked her mother if she could drive the car to the store herself. Anna's mom said, "Sure, ten-year-olds drive themselves to the store all the time!" What kind of irony is used in this story?

Answers

Verbal Irony

Verbal Irony occurs when a speaker's intention is the opposite of what he or she is saying.

Anna’s mom said that ten year-olds drive thenselves to the store all the time. When in reality, we all know this is false. Young children cannot drive themselves anywhere.

In November 1927, Joseph Stalin launched his "revolution from above” by setting two extraordinary goals for Soviet domestic policy: rapid industrialization and collectivization of agriculture. His aims were to erase all traces of the capitalism that had entered under the New Economic Policy and to transform the Soviet Union as quickly as possible, without regard to cost, into an industrialized and completely socialist state. Stalin's First Five-Year Plan, adopted by the party in 1928, called for rapid industrialization of the economy, with an emphasis on heavy industry. It set goals that were unrealistic—a 250 percent increase in overall industrial development and a 330 percent expansion in heavy industry alone. All industry and services were nationalized, managers were given predetermined output quotas by central planners, and trade unions were converted into mechanisms for increasing worker productivity.
